Dougherty (formerly Doughtery) is a small unincorporated community in Floyd County, Texas, United States.

History

Dougherty was established in 1928 and named for Francis M. Dougherty.[2] A school was built in 1929.[2]

Geography

Dougherty is located on the high plains of the Llano Estacado in West Texas. It lies at an elevation of 3,077 ft (938 m).[1]
